Singer 2Baba, formerly known as 2Face Idibia, has revealed that his 2004 hit ‘African Queen’ has been both a blessing and a problem in his career.
In an interview on the Entertainment & Lifestyle show, he said, “African Queen has been a very huge blessing, and e come turn to problem join for me. But I am grateful for everything.”
The track, released on his debut solo album Face 2 Face, propelled 2Baba from Nigerian R&B singer to global Afrobeats star. Its mix of folk guitar riffs and lyrics made it an instant love anthem, earning him international recognition and awards, including BET and MOBO honours.
Despite the success, 2Baba admitted the fame came with challenges. The track was also at the centre of a long-running authorship dispute, with his former group-mate Blackface of Plantashun Boiz claiming credit for writing it. 2Baba has denied these claims while acknowledging their collaboration.
